      Eating too quickly linked to obesity and increased risk of heart disease,
diabetes and stroke.
        吃饭太快——肥胖、心脏病、糖尿病和中风的元凶?
    Eating slowly could make you less likely to become obese or develop
metabolic syndrome, according to preliminary research.
    初步研究:细嚼慢咽不太可能让人患上肥胖或代谢综合征。
    This is likely because eating quickly may cause fluctuations in your blood
sugar, which can lead to insulin resistance.
    这可能是因为吃得太快会导致血糖波动,从而导致胰岛素抵抗(译者注:胰岛素抵抗指各种原因使胰岛素促进葡萄糖摄取和利用的效率下降)。
    Metabolic syndrome is a combination of disorders that multiply a person’s
risk for heart disease, diabetes and stroke.
    代谢综合征是一种紊乱综合征,会增加患心脏病、糖尿病和中风的风险。
    It occurs when someone has any of three risk factors that include abdominal
obesity, high fasting blood sugar, high blood pressure, high triglycerides
and/or low HDL cholesterol.
    当一个人有腹部肥胖、高血糖、高血压、高甘油三酯/或低HDL胆固醇(译者注:HDL胆固醇就是高密度脂蛋白胆固醇,能促进外周组织中胆固醇的消除,防止动脉粥样硬化)这些症状时,往往就会患有代谢综合征。
    According to research presented at the American Heart Association’s
Scientific Sessions 2017, eating more slowly could be the key to keeping your
health and body in check.
    根据美国心脏协会2017年科学会议的研究,细嚼慢咽可能是保持身体健康的关键。
    A team from Hiroshima University in Japan evaluated 642 men and 441 women
with an average age of 51.2 years, none of whom had metabolic syndrome, in
2008.
    2008年,日本广岛大学的研究人员对平均年龄为51.2岁的642名男性和441名女性进行了评估,没有一个患有代谢综合症。
    The participants were divided into three categories based on how they
described their usual eating speed: slow, normal or fast.
    研究人员根据他们描述的日常饮食速度将其分为三类:慢速、正常和快速。
    Five years later, the researchers reassessed the participants.
    五年后,研究人员重新对他们进行了测评。
    They found that the fast eaters were more likely (11.6 per cent) to have
developed metabolic syndrome than normal eaters (6.5 per cent) and slow eaters
(2.3 per cent).
    他们发现,快食者(11.6%)比正常饮食者(6.5%)和慢食者(2.3%)更易患上代谢综合症。
    Eating quickly was also linked to more weight gain, larger waistline and
higher blood glucose.
    吃得快也常常伴随着体重增加、腰围增大和血糖升高。
    Taking the time to consciously chew your food and eat slowly allows for
your brain to receive fullness signals, so you’re more likely to stop eating
earlier.
    花点时间下意识咀嚼食物,慢慢吃,大脑就会接收到你吃饱了的信号,这样你就更可能尽早停止进食。
    “Eating more slowly may be a crucial lifestyle change to help prevent
metabolic syndrome,” said Takayuki Yamaji, M.D., study author and cardiologist
at Hiroshima University in Japan.
    日本广岛大学的研究作者和心脏病专家Takayuki Yamaji,
M.D说:“细嚼慢咽可能是生活方式的一次重要改变,这样做有助于预防代谢综合征。”
    “When people eat fast they tend not to feel full and are more likely to
overeat. Eating fast causes bigger glucose fluctuation, which can lead to
insulin resistance. We also believe our research would apply to a U.S.
population.”
    “人们进食快时往往不觉得饱,就很可能会吃得更多,从而导致血糖波动大进而导致胰岛素抵抗。我们也相信我们的研究是适用于(全体)美国人民的。”
